package statvar
import (
"context"
pb "github.com/datacommonsorg/mixer/internal/proto"
"github.com/datacommonsorg/mixer/internal/store"
"github.com/datacommonsorg/mixer/internal/store/bigtable"
"google.golang.org/grpc/codes"
"google.golang.org/grpc/status"
"google.golang.org/protobuf/proto"
)
// GetStatVarSummaryHelper is a wrapper to get stat var summary.
func GetStatVarSummaryHelper(
ctx context.Context, entities []string, store *store.Store) (
map[string]*pb.StatVarSummary, error) {
btDataList, err := bigtable.Read(
ctx,
store.BtGroup,
bigtable.BtStatVarSummary,
[][]string{entities},
func(jsonRaw []byte) (interface{}, error) {
var statVarSummary pb.StatVarSummary
if err := proto.Unmarshal(jsonRaw, &statVarSummary); err != nil {
return nil, err
}
return &statVarSummary, nil
},
)
if err != nil {
return nil, err
}
result := map[string]*pb.StatVarSummary{}
// Merge strategy
// 1. "place_type_summary": For a given place type, pick the Bigtable with the
// most places.
// 2. "provenance_summary": Merge provenances from all the Bigtables.
for _, btData := range btDataList {
for _, row := range btData {
dcid := row.Parts[0]
svs, ok := row.Data.(*pb.StatVarSummary)
if !ok {
return nil, status.Errorf(codes.Internal, "Can not read StatVarSummary")
}
if _, ok := result[dcid]; !ok {
result[dcid] = svs
continue
}
res := result[dcid]
// Pick place type summary with the most places.
for pt := range svs.PlaceTypeSummary {
summary, ok := res.PlaceTypeSummary[pt]
if ok && svs.PlaceTypeSummary[pt].PlaceCount < summary.PlaceCount {
continue
}
res.PlaceTypeSummary[pt] = svs.PlaceTypeSummary[pt]
}
//
for source := range svs.ProvenanceSummary {
// Only set the the source if it has not been found in a preferred
// import group.
if _, ok := res.ProvenanceSummary[source]; !ok {
res.ProvenanceSummary[source] = svs.ProvenanceSummary[source]
}
}
}
}
return result, nil
}
